Giovanni Battista Tiepolo created this print, ‘Woman kneeling in front of magicians and other figures, from the Scherzi’, using etching. The print's composition is immediately striking, presenting a scene teeming with figures rendered in stark contrasts of light and shadow. Tiepolo employs a dynamic interplay of line and form to create a sense of drama and intrigue. The rough, almost frenzied lines lend the scene a raw, unfiltered quality, heightening the emotional intensity. The kneeling woman dominates the foreground, drawing our eye with her vulnerability against the backdrop of looming magicians and other figures. The cylindrical altar-like structure emphasizes the ritualistic and theatrical nature of the scene. This print challenges traditional notions of beauty and order. The piece destabilizes established categories, inviting us to question fixed meanings and embrace ambiguity.
